How long should a sparring session last?

Make sure your sparring partner is an even match in terms of weight and experience-level. Only commit to 3-4, two-minute rounds. It may sound easy, but sparring is intense and you are definitely going to feel every round.

How hard should you hit in sparring?

How hard you hit during sparring depends on the goals and intensity of your sparring session. For a hard session, hit hard as you expect to be hit hard. For a light session, hit with less intensity as the goal is to sharpen technique and skill. To get better at boxing, blend both hard and light sparring.

Can I box every day?

I would advise not to box every day as having at least one day off is good for mental and physical recovery. However, boxing every day can be done but your easy days must be very easy. They can consist of pure technique work or light aerobic conditioning.

Can I box without sparring?

To answer the original question – yes, you can learn to box without sparring. Don’t expect to be able to use those skills without practicing them though. If you want to be a real “boxer” – and actually have the skills to fight someone off, there’s no better place to practice those skills than in the ring.
